Desert Pocket Gopher vs Grand Ecureuil De Stanger
Geomys arenarius compared with Protoxerus stangeri
Key Differences
- Desert Pocket Gopher is Near Threatened while Grand Ecureuil De Stanger is Least Concern.
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Desert Pocket Gopher | Grand Ecureuil De Stanger |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(animal) | Animalia (animal) |
| Phylum same | Chordata (Chordates) | Chordata (Chordates) |
| Class same | Mammalia (mammifères) | Mammalia (mammifères) |
| Order same | Rodentia (Rodents) | Rodentia (Rodents) |
| Family | Geomyidae | Sciuridae (Squirrels) |
| Genus | Geomys | Protoxerus |
| Species | Geomys arenarius | Protoxerus stangeri |
Evolutionary Relationship
Desert Pocket Gopher and Grand Ecureuil De Stanger share a common ancestor at the Order level: Rodentia. (Rodents)
